Landscape edging services involve installing a defined boundary between different areas of a yard, such as between flower beds, lawns, pathways, and driveways. This work typically includes selecting the appropriate edging material-like metal, plastic, stone, or brick-and carefully installing it to create a clean, organized appearance. Proper edging not only enhances the overall look of outdoor spaces but also helps prevent soil, mulch, or gravel from spilling into adjacent areas, making yard maintenance easier and more efficient. Local contractors experienced in landscape edging can tailor their work to match the specific style and layout of each property, ensuring a seamless integration with existing landscaping features.

One common issue that landscape edging helps address is the containment of mulch, gravel, or soil in designated planting beds. Without a proper boundary, these materials can spread into lawns or walkways, creating a messy appearance and making upkeep more difficult. Edging also helps control grass encroachment into flower beds, reducing the need for frequent trimming and weed control. Additionally, it can serve as a barrier to pests or animals that might disturb garden areas. Property owners who notice their landscaping materials spilling over or their lawns blending into planting beds often find that professional edging provides a neat, tidy solution that saves time and effort over the long term.

What is landscape edging? Landscape edging is a technique used to create a defined border between different areas of a yard, such as flower beds and lawns, to improve appearance and prevent soil or mulch from spilling into other areas.

What materials are used for landscape edging? Local contractors offer a variety of materials including brick, stone, metal, plastic, and wood, allowing for customization based on style and durability preferences.

How does landscape edging benefit a yard? Proper edging helps maintain clean lines, reduces weed spread, and keeps mulch or soil contained, making outdoor spaces easier to maintain and visually appealing.

Can landscape edging be installed around existing plants? Yes, experienced service providers can install edging around existing plants and features without damaging them, ensuring a seamless look.

What types of landscape edging are suitable for different yard styles? Different materials and styles suit various yard aesthetics, from natural stone for rustic looks to metal or plastic for modern designs, with local contractors able to recommend options that match the landscape.
